# Break-Glass: Catalog Cache Invalidation

Scope: the Pinrow product catalog at Veldstone Retail. If stale prices persist after a purge and the Hollowmere invalidation queue is wedged, use break-glass to flush the edge tier directly. Contractors: get verbal sign-off from the catalog lead first. Steps: open the Hollowmere admin shell, select emergency-flush, confirm the tenant, and run it once — repeated flushes thrash the origin. Access is logged and expires after 20 minutes. Unseal the admin shell with the passphrase below.

recovery phrase for kahop-tajog: istix-casvan

## Validator Plugins — Quick Context

Welcome! Checkwright loads validator plugins at startup from the registry manifest; each plugin declares its schema scope and a priority. When reviewing plugin PRs, run the conformance suite locally first — it catches most interface drift. The suite needs to talk to the internal registry service, so authenticate with the key below.

gateway credential: kto23_LX9A4ys6i4nzHtpOLNLodKK

Ticket: Missed pick-up — key-card stock

The blank key-card stock for the new Fernleigh Annex was not collected Monday as scheduled; the Quickbarrow courier reported a routing error. The sealed carton remains locked in the supplies cupboard and should stay there until collection. A new pick-up window is set for Wednesday afternoon. Please have someone present to witness the transfer. At hand-over, follow the confidential instruction appended directly below.

dispatch memo: the eliath belael courier leaves the praox ledger at gate 8841 under passcode 017589

**Ticket: Staging env misconfigured — ws compression flapping**

Hey Marisol — staging for Pondlark has permessage-deflate enabled but the context-takeover flag got dropped in the last env rewrite, so we're burning CPU recompressing every frame. The tradeoff doc says: compression on for dashboard streams, off for the tick feed. I've fixed the flags, but the proxy now also needs its upstream auth token redeclared since the env file was regenerated. Add it right after the compression block, on the next line.

secret setting of hawep-yahig: LEDGER_TOKEN29=41b5d6315371c92885eaeb077fb63